任意两个点的曲线连接JS算法
💡
原文中文,约2500字,阅读约需6分钟。
📝
内容提要
本文介绍了如何使用Canvas实现任意两点之间的曲线连接,控制点的位置可以确定,使用context.bezierCurveTo()方法,可以大大简化开发成本的Fabric.js也有提及。
🎯
关键要点
-
文章介绍了如何使用Canvas实现任意两点之间的曲线连接。
-
使用context.bezierCurveTo()方法可以简化开发成本。
-
控制点的位置可以确定,影响曲线的形状。
-
Canvas提供了原生的曲线绘制方法,包括二次和三次贝塞尔曲线。
-
示例代码展示了如何绘制曲线并描边。
-
最终实现支持拖拽方块,曲线实时跟随。
-
Fabric.js可以进一步简化Canvas图形编辑的开发过程。
➡️